WebSep 8, 2012 · Git Bash: Navigating the File System (cd) Syntax: cd [options] [] Navigate to the Home Directory (Default folder for the current user): $ cd Navigate to a specific folder in the file system: $ cd /c/SomeFolder/SomeOtherFolder/ Navigate to a specific folder in the file system (if there are spaces in the directory path):

Enter git add --all at the command line prompt in your local project directory to add the files or changes to the repository. Enter git status to see the changes to be committed. In the command line, navigate to the root directory of your project. Initialize the local directory as a Git repository. Stage and commit all the files in your project.
